About Moncel Moncel is one of the fastest growing companies in the online education space. With 7 international brands, and operations in Canada, Australia, and the United States, we are an exciting blend of the technology and learning sectors. Our company is made up of a rapidly growing team of talented professionals, focused on delivering the highest standard of online training to the food and hospitality sectors worldwide.
Over the last decade our start-up has grown from a small team of two in Brisbane, Australia to a global group determined to improve the way online education is performed.
In addition to our business goals in commercial training & education services, we are proud of our commitments to charitable activities. Moncel regularly engages with and donates to organizations that support the community in the area of public health, as well as helping feed tens of thousands of people each year.
About The Role The Sales Representative at Moncel is a dynamic remote-first role focused on engaging B2B clients across Canada and the United States. This maternity cover position drives revenue through inbound lead conversion and outbound prospecting. You build and maintain professional relationships by phone and email, qualify and nurture leads throughout the sales cycle, and report directly to the President of Moncel. You work independently to exceed sales targets and maximize commission potential in a fast-paced, high-performance environment.
